Local tech companies say new IT tax could push them out of Maryland

from #LegalBytes: The Official Podcast of Cummings & Cummings Law · host Cummings & Cummings Law

Maryland’s new 3 percent tax on data and information technology services represents more than a revenue measure, and it is causing companies to relocate out of Maryland. It signals a shift in how the state treats its technology sector. In this presentation, attorney and CPA Chad D. Cummings examines the real-world impact of House Bill 352 on small and mid-sized technology companies, including documented cases where business owners face material increases in their effective tax burden that cannot be passed through to clients in a competitive regional market. The discussion explains why relocation decisions are driven not only by the tax itself but by broader concerns about policy trajectory, regulatory predictability, and the ability to recruit and retain talent. It also analyzes how states such as Florida and Texas position themselves to receive this migrating capital, and why many of the most consequential business departures occur quietly without public announcements.
